What?s the Job? The Manufacturing Infrastructure Support Technician position will join a new team dedicated to develop, support, maintain and troubleshoot…
What?s the Job? The Manufacturing Infrastructure Support Technician position will join a new team dedicated to develop, support, maintain and troubleshoot…